Is VyprVPN safe to use

VyprVPN doesn't store any logs and other than on iOS, all of its apps come with a built-in kill switch. There's protection against DNS leaks, but WebRTC and IPv6 leak protection are not guaranteed. You can check out our recommended VPNs for torrenting.

Is VyprVPN better than ExpressVPN

ExpressVPN has the best server coverage overall. It has one of the largest server networks which is made up of over 3,000 servers across 94 countries. VyprVPN offers servers in approximately 60 countries. However, the big difference is that there are only around 700 servers in all.

Who owns VyprVPN

Golden Frog

VyprVPN, owned by the Switzerland-based digital services firm Golden Frog, beats the prices of many VPNs with a $10 month-to-month rate and a $60 annual option that cuts the monthly expense to $5.

What are the cons of VyprVPN

The one really lacking thing about VyprVPN subscriptions is the payment options. You can't pay using cryptocurrencies. There are only regular credit card options, PayPal, and UnionPay. If you're focused on your privacy, that can be a drawback as well.

What will a VPN not protect you from

A VPN helps you stay invisible and behind the scenes, but it doesn't give you immunity against online risks like malware, ransomware, phishing attacks, or even computer viruses. That's where your antivirus software comes in.
